It's important to have a spare key fob on to hand in the event that yours gets lost, damaged or just dead. You can save money on towing and dealer service fees by having a spare key. You can call an automotive locksmith who can provide Subaru key replacement for your car if you don't own a spare. They can give you keys right on the spot.

Certain Subaru models have the "push to start" feature, which allows the car to start by pressing the lock on the key fob. This type of key comes with a transponder chip and requires reconfiguring to work. You'll need to have the 8-digit transmitter number that can be found in the owner's guide or by contacting your local Subaru dealership.

It's easy and cheap to replace the battery in the most modern Subaru key fobs. To take off the key made of steel, first locate the small silver tab at the back of the fob. Push it in. Then, use an flathead screwdriver and place it into the seam between the front and back of the key fob. Once you get into it, you will notice the flat battery that must be replaced.

A Subaru transponder is a key that has a chip within. The chip is used to unlock the vehicle and also to start the motor. When you have the key for your car replaced, the new key has to be programmed to work with your car. This type of key cannot be made using standard key cutting equipment. replacing a subaru key Subaru locksmith is equipped with the tools required to program a brand new Subaru car key.

If you have a conventional metallic key, you won't require a Subaru car key programming service. This is because a traditional key does not have the microchip.
